Question Z-roc or Cowl??

just like the topic, what should i get for my 94 z28? There both around the same price so what looks best once its all put on and painted?? Do cowls add any power by cooling the engine bay down? Thanks.

I think he just means that there is no reason for our 4th gens to have a cowl hood(angle of windsheild too shallow to make it work, engine under windsheild no need for hood clearance, etc)

And some would consider it to be "white grain" if you add something to your car and it doesn't belong or is out of place or doesn't make it go faster or.....

Anyway, personally, I like them, but for my car I must have function, I'm going SS
